How many characteristics do all living things share? The answer, surprisingly, is quite a few. Despite the vast diversity of life on Earth, there are several fundamental traits that all living organisms possess. These characteristics not only define what it means to be alive but also provide a foundation for understanding the intricate relationships and processes that govern the natural world.

One of the most fundamental characteristics shared by all living things is the ability to grow and develop. From the simplest single-celled organisms to the most complex multicellular organisms, growth is a universal process that allows living organisms to adapt to their environment and increase in size. This characteristic is essential for survival, as it enables organisms to repair damaged tissues, reproduce, and compete for resources.

Another shared trait is the ability to respond to stimuli. All living organisms have some form of sensory organs or receptors that allow them to detect and react to changes in their surroundings. This response mechanism is crucial for survival, as it enables organisms to avoid danger, seek food, and interact with other organisms.

Metabolism is another characteristic that unites all living things. Metabolism refers to the chemical processes that occur within an organism to maintain life. These processes include the conversion of nutrients into energy, the synthesis of new molecules, and the elimination of waste products. Metabolism is essential for growth, reproduction, and overall functioning of living organisms.

Reproduction is a key characteristic shared by all living things. While the methods of reproduction vary widely among different organisms, the end goal is the same: to produce offspring. Reproduction ensures the continuity of life and allows for the passing on of genetic information from one generation to the next.

Homeostasis, or the ability to maintain a stable internal environment, is another shared trait. All living organisms have mechanisms in place to regulate their internal conditions, such as temperature, pH, and water balance. This homeostasis is crucial for the proper functioning of cells and tissues, as well as the overall health of the organism.

Lastly, all living things share the characteristic of having a cellular structure. Cells are the basic units of life, and all living organisms are composed of one or more cells. These cells carry out the essential functions of life, such as metabolism, growth, and reproduction.

In conclusion, despite the incredible diversity of life on Earth, there are several fundamental characteristics that all living things share. These traits include growth, responsiveness to stimuli, metabolism, reproduction, homeostasis, and cellular structure.
